French born Sempe is a newspaper cartoonist. His first collection of drawings appeared in 1962 : “Rien n’est simple” (Nothing is simple). This was followed by about thirty more, all humurous masterpieces beautifully reflecting his tender and ironic vision of our flaws and those of the world around us. He is one of the greatest French cartoonists since over forty years. Sempé is one of the rare cartoonists to have illustrated the covers of the very prestigious “New Yorker”, and is currently entertaining millions of readers in “Paris Match”.
